Output 669d22b51b4fce4e4453c495e55a2d51ff55e8e09c8869fc5bc8c6c9fd9cdcd6:4

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b787d8a945572ccea19063fc470aff156140a9a OP_EQUAL
address
34CGWYRhuocztsKsqhmxnW9bFMGgg1MraH
transaction
669d22b51b4fce4e4453c495e55a2d51ff55e8e09c8869fc5bc8c6c9fd9cdcd6
confirmations
414146
spent
true